Wasting disease, also commonly referred to as chronic weight loss or skinny disease, describes a progressive condition where aquarium fish gradually lose body mass despite appearing to eat normally or adequately. Affected fish develop a characteristic emaciated appearance with a sunken belly, visible skeletal structure, and a head that appears disproportionately large compared to the wasted body. This condition represents a significant diagnostic challenge because it is a symptom complex rather than a single disease, potentially resulting from numerous underlying causes including internal parasites, bacterial infections, intestinal disorders, or nutritional deficiencies.
Wasting disease affects a wide range of aquarium fish species, though certain groups demonstrate particular vulnerability. Discus fish are notorious for developing wasting, often due to internal flagellates or the stress-sensitive nature of this species. Angelfish and other cichlids frequently present with chronic weight loss. Neon tetras and related small characins develop a specific wasting condition often called neon tetra disease. Wild-caught fish of any species face elevated risk due to the internal parasites they commonly carry. Both freshwater and marine fish can be affected, though the specific underlying causes may differ between these environments.
The impact of wasting disease on fish health extends far beyond the obvious weight loss. As the body depletes its energy reserves, the immune system becomes compromised, leaving fish vulnerable to secondary infections. Organ function deteriorates as the body essentially begins consuming itself to survive. Reproductive capacity is lost as the body prioritizes survival over breeding. The chronic stress associated with the condition further suppresses immune function, creating a downward spiral that becomes increasingly difficult to reverse. Affected fish often become socially marginalized within their groups, adding behavioral stress to their physical burden.
Treatability of wasting disease depends heavily on identifying and addressing the underlying cause. When caught early and properly diagnosed, many cases respond well to appropriate treatment, whether that involves anti-parasitic medications, antibiotics, dietary improvements, or environmental optimization. However, advanced cases where significant body condition has already been lost carry a guarded prognosis. Early detection remains crucial, as treatment success rates decline significantly once the wasting has progressed to severe stages.
